Our Partner & Developer boards on the community are moving to a brand new home: the .dev community forums! While you can still access past discussions here, for all your future app and storefront building questions, head over to the new forums.

Webhooks for Purchase Orders

Solved

Webhooks for Purchase Orders

sergeich
Shopify Partner
5 0 1

Is there a way to listen to Purchase Order events via the Webhook system? This seems to be unsupported now (https://shopify.dev/docs/api/admin-graphql/2023-07/enums/WebhookSubscriptionTopic

Accepted Solution (1)

Liam
Community Manager
3108 344 911

This is an accepted solution.

Hi Sergeich,

 

From looking into this there doesn't seem to be an easy way to listen for purchase order related events via a webhook, or our API. The closest I could find is the `suppliers_update` webhook but this is in our unstable API version, so it wouldn't be recommended to use in any production environment. I'll pass on this feedback however as a feature request to see if it can be exposed in future updates. 

 

Hope this helps,

Liam | Developer Advocate @ Shopify 
 - Was my reply helpful? Click Like to let me know! 
 - Was your question answered? Mark it as an Accepted Solution
 - To learn more visit Shopify.dev or the Shopify Web Design and Development Blog

View solution in original post

Replies 9 (9)

Liam
Community Manager
3108 344 911

This is an accepted solution.

Hi Sergeich,

 

From looking into this there doesn't seem to be an easy way to listen for purchase order related events via a webhook, or our API. The closest I could find is the `suppliers_update` webhook but this is in our unstable API version, so it wouldn't be recommended to use in any production environment. I'll pass on this feedback however as a feature request to see if it can be exposed in future updates. 

 

Hope this helps,

Liam | Developer Advocate @ Shopify 
 - Was my reply helpful? Click Like to let me know! 
 - Was your question answered? Mark it as an Accepted Solution
 - To learn more visit Shopify.dev or the Shopify Web Design and Development Blog

Hotcrown
Visitor
1 0 0

can i have more information about the "supplier update" webhook, i didnt suceed to find it in the list of webhooks?

FKI
Shopify Partner
9 1 0

I see a bunch of webhooks relating to Purchase Orders in the unstable API version; unfortunately none of them are in the latest 2024-1 release candidate. Is there a timeline for their incorporation in the stable API? 

Liam
Community Manager
3108 344 911

There is no guarantee that events or endpoints in the unstable version will be added into the stable version of the API - I will ask internally if these events are on the road map however.

Liam | Developer Advocate @ Shopify 
 - Was my reply helpful? Click Like to let me know! 
 - Was your question answered? Mark it as an Accepted Solution
 - To learn more visit Shopify.dev or the Shopify Web Design and Development Blog

Tristan3dt
Shopify Partner
39 0 18

Hi, is there any update on this please?

cooperandco
Shopify Partner
18 1 4

Hey Liam,

 

Hope you're doing well!

 

Just wanted to touch base regarding the integration of Webhooks with Purchase Orders. It's been on our radar for a bit, and we're eager to see if there's any progress or updates on this front. This integration could really open up some exciting new functionalities for our partners and app developers.

 

Could you spare a moment to chat with the team and give us a heads-up on where things stand with these events being added to the roadmap?

 

Thanks a bunch for your time!

 

Sam Cooper
Cooper & Co - Shopify Experts
Cooper & Co Website

Reynaldo_Zabala
Excursionist
11 0 10

Our team is also looking to incorporate Purchase Order creation events to Shopify Flow so we can autogenerate purchase orders in our accounting System (quickbooks). We cannot figure out a way to determine when a Purchase Order has been created in the Admin interface.

23c2029c
Shopify Partner
2 0 0

is the purchase order event through webhook is solved or not ?

jakeredone
Shopify Partner
1 0 0

Still in the unstable version, couldn't seem to test it out even using the unstable version however as they make it difficult to even create the subscription to the webhook itself. Shopify needs to work on getting this out asap since it seems to be a very important feature for especially large businesses.